blackmailer
勒索者
常用释义
英音[ ˈblækmeɪlə(r) ]
美音[ ˈblækmeɪlər ]
变形
复数:
blackmailers
基本释义
- n. 勒索者;敲诈者
例句
-
1·The nasty thing about a blackmailer is that his starting point is usually the truth.讨厌的事情在于,敲诈者开始借以要挟的把柄往往是事实。来源: 《柯林斯英汉双解大词典》
-
2·The blackmailer bled him for $20000.勒索者勒索他两万美金。
-
3·The blackmailer bled him for 500 pounds.敲诈者向他勒索500英镑。
-
4·The blackmailer had to be paid off. He was too dangerous.只得向那个敲诈勒索者付钱了,他太危险了。
-
5·The blackmailer tried to extort a large sum of money from him.勒索者企图向他勒索一大笔钱。
-
6·The blackmailer will have to be bought off, or he'll ruin your good name.得花些钱疏通那个敲诈者,否则他会毁坏你的声誉。
-
7·The blackmailer warned his victim that if he went to the police he would regret it.敲诈犯警告被敲诈的人说,如果他报警,会后悔的。
-
8·When you pay off a blackmailer, she gets your money, but all you get is her word not to disclose.当你付钱给勒索者时,她拿走你的钱,但你得到的只是她不去揭露的承诺。
-
9·Often the blackmailer will claim that the person would only have helped them if they were responsible for the accident.通常情况下,敲诈者会认为帮助他们的人就是事故责任人。
-
10·In Tirana, after I returned from Moscow, I felt the city, like some importunate blackmailer, still claiming its unpaid dues.告别莫斯科,重归地拉那,自己总觉得家乡依然催命般地在找我算账。
